The Dos and Don’ts if you Face a Water Damage


What to do immediately




  • Immediately turn off the source of water to stop further damage


  • The breaker should also be turned off in the damaged area


  • Switch of any electrical devices that may be in the affected area


  • Lift up draperies and put a pin on the furniture skirts to prevent them from getting wet


  • Remove things from the carpet that may leave stains such as newspaper, books, plants, baskets etc.


  • If you have home insurance, call up the company to send someone to assess the damage


  • If you are removing stuff before their arrival, click photographs so that they can assess the damage


  • Call up a reliable water damage restoration company. They are proficient in handling such situations which helps minimize damage


  • Move any valuable stuff such as paintings, art work, photographs etc from the damaged area.


  • Remove any small furniture from the wet area and move to dry, safe regions


  • Wipe furniture and open drawers to enable quick drying

  • What you should not do




  • Never try to use home vacuum cleaners to dry wet areas. You may get an electric shock


  • Do not walk on the wet area more than necessary as it may cause water to spread in the dry areas


  • Never try to dry wet areas using newspapers. Its ink spreads fast and may aggravate damage


  • Never switch on TV or other electrical appliances on the wet carpet or floor


  • Do not use HVAC system if it has been affected by water


  • Do not disturb visible mold. It is best treated by professionals
